Salt Lake City (SLC) to Isla Rey Jorge (TNM) Flight Distance
The flight distance from Salt Lake City International Airport (SLC) in Salt Lake City, United States to Teniente Rodolfo Marsh Martin Base (TNM) in Isla Rey Jorge, AQ is 12,389 kilometers (7,698 miles / 6,690 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 16h, flying south southeast at a heading of 156°.
